Learn more about Market Harborough

This charming market town showcases its heritage at Harborough Museum and along the picturesque canal basin with distinctive architecture. Explore the bustling indoor market for local crafts, then wander the independent shops and cafés along High Street and Church Square.

Best time to go to Market Harborough

The best time to visit Market Harborough can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Market Harborough falls in July and August. August has average visitor numbers and mostly cloudy weather. The coolest average temperature in Market Harborough fal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

What's the weather like in Market Harborough?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 16°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 5°C. Average annual precipitation for Market Harborough is 713 mm.
